Influences: I grew up hearing crickets chirp outside my door, in a place where the water tasted sweet and I named crawdads in the creek next to my house. In the summer, you could taste the smell of sweet onions and earth. Walla Walla is rich in history and was a stopping point on the Lewis & Clark trail. Wheat fields, orchards and vineyards abound. We have been given the title "Little Napa Valley". I am the second daughter and fourth child in a family of eight children. The greatest influence I can attribute to my writing would be my parents, both possessing intelligence, wit, courage and a romantic spirit. My grandparents, both maternal and paternal, were farmers who instilled in me a love and respect for the earth...
